Catalog description

Class Hours: 3 Lab/Discussion: 0 Credits: 3 Prerequisite: CRIM 101 or CRIM 102 or departmental permission Description: The evolution and development of the modern legal system. Topics include civil, criminal, and administration law, the legal profession, legal systems in American society, and the law as one of many instruments of social control and social change.
